At Flaviar, we are committed to providing the most compliant payment gateway solution. As part of this commitment, we are excited to announce an important update to our brand's payment gateway on all Shopify stores we manage. This upgrade involves transitioning from the traditional Active Merchant payment integration to the more advanced Stripe Payment App.

Why the Change?

Stripe has long been a trusted partner in processing online payments, and Shopify has been a reliable platform for e-commerce. Historically, our payment gateway integration with Stripe was facilitated through Active Merchant, a library that provided a standardized interface for various payment gateways. However, as technology evolves, so do the needs and expectations of businesses and consumers. To stay ahead, we are adopting the latest and most efficient solutions. This includes updating all stores to Stripe's new Payment App.

The Migration Process

We understand that any change can be daunting, especially when it involves critical components like payment processing. That's why we are committed to making this transition as smooth as possible. Here's what you can expect:

  1. Stripe/Shopify are releasing the updates in batches, meaning this update may not be available to all of our partner stores at the same time. We'll know your store is ready for the upgrade once we see this alert in your Shopify store

  2. The update process only takes a few minutes and will be entirely managed by our team.

  3. Once we make the update the store owner will receive two back-to-back notifications from Shopify

    1. The first one will say your payment gateway (Stripe) has been deactivated.

    2. The second one will say Stripe Card Payments has been activated as your payment gateway.

  4. We do not expect any do expect anytime downtime on your store during the update, but we will make the update outside of the normal business hours just in case.

  5. Once Stripe Card Payments is activated, we may complete a test order to double-check payments are processing as expected.

New Features

Previously, the only quick-pay option available with the Stripe Payment Gateway was Apple Pay. Once Stripe Card Payments is activated in your store, we'll be ready to enable Google Pay as well.

Limitations

Currently, we are not aware of many limitations with Stripe's new payment processor except with subscription orders. Stripe has confirmed their new payment gateway is not yet compatible with recurring subscription orders.

If you are set up with Stripe's newest payment processing app (Stripe Card Payments) and would like to start offering subscriptions please let us know so we can find a solution for you.
